How to Choose the Best Spot for Your TV
Where is the ideal spot to place a TV for the best viewing experience? The best location copyrights on several key factors, including the layout of the room, the seating configuration, and the lighting environment. Choosing a wall that reduces glare from natural and artificial light sources is key to an enjoyable viewing experience. Placing the TV at seated eye level optimizes visibility and minimizes strain on the neck.
Additionally, the distance from the viewing area is a crucial factor; the advised distance usually spans from 1.5 to 2.5 times the diagonal screen size. This makes certain that individuals can take in the image quality without causing eye strain.
Evaluate the space's focal point; the TV should enhance the room rather than dominate it. Lastly, convenience for wiring solutions and future read the full story improvements should also factor into the selection. By weighing these factors, one can identify a location that maximizes both decorative value and usability, creating an immersive home theater environment.
What Tools Do You Need for Wall Mounting?
To successfully mount a TV on the wall, possessing the correct tools is crucial. A stud detector is vital for finding wall studs, guaranteeing a secure mount. A level makes certain that the TV hangs straight, while a measuring tape assists with accurate positioning. A power drill is required for boring pilot holes, and screws suited to the wall mount design should be on hand. Additionally, a socket or wrench may be needed for tightening bolts.
Safety goggles are essential to protect eyes during installation, and a screwdriver is necessary for properly securing all components. When mounting larger TVs, having a second person helps with handling and positioning. Furthermore, cable organization tools, including clips or ties, ensure a neat and tidy finish. With these tools, the mounting process becomes efficient, leading to an ideal viewing experience.
Typical Installation Errors to Avoid
Installing a TV can easily become a frustrating process when common errors are ignored. Numerous homeowners fail to confirm wall stud positions, resulting in insufficient support and possible damage. Failing to use the correct mounting bracket type can result in instability, risking the TV's safety. Moreover, ignoring proper cable management commonly creates a cluttered arrangement, taking away from the overall visual appeal.
One other frequent oversight is wrong height placement; positioning the mount too high or too low can negatively affect viewing comfort. Overlooking the manufacturer's guidelines during the installation process can also create hazards, as each model may have specific requirements. Additionally, failing to verify the level before fastening the mount can lead to an uneven display. By sidestepping these common errors, individuals can secure a smoother installation process and elevate their home cinema experience.

Perfect Viewing Distance
What is the best way to find the perfect screen distance for a television? The primary factors affecting this distance are the display size and image quality. For conventional HD displays, a popular recommendation is to sit approximately 1.5 to 2.5 times the screen's diagonal measurement from the display. For 4K Ultra HD televisions, this distance can be reduced to about 1 to 1.5 times the display's diagonal size, enabling viewers to enjoy finer details without eye discomfort. Moreover, considerations like seating height, room configuration, and individual preferences significantly influence the ideal viewing distance. In the end, the best viewing experience comes from harmonizing these factors to ensure visual comfort and clarity, creating an immersive home theater environment.
Surround Speaker Placement
Reaching an engaging audio experience is greatly influenced by the careful placement of surround sound speakers. For best results, the front speakers should be positioned at ear level, surrounding the television to create a harmonious sound stage. The center speaker should be directly over or under the screen, securing dialogue clarity. Rear speakers can be placed slightly above ear level, set about 2 feet behind the listening area to enhance depth. Subwoofers should be situated in corners or along walls to maximize bass response, as their placement can considerably affect sound quality. Room acoustics also hold significant importance; soft furnishings can reduce sound, while hard surfaces may reflect it. Thorough calibration following placement delivers a premier audio experience, improving the home cinema environment.

Essential Maintenance Advice for Your Wall-Mounted TV Setup
Consistent care of a wall-mounted TV setup is crucial for guaranteeing ideal performance and longevity. To begin, clean the screen and nearby surfaces regularly to prevent buildup, which can affect ventilation and picture quality. Use a microfiber cloth and refrain from using strong chemicals that may deteriorate the display surface.
Additionally, review the installation hardware at regular intervals to make sure all screws and brackets remain tight. Loose fittings can contribute to loosening and potential harm.
In addition, examine cables for wear or fraying, exchanging those that display signs of wear. This helps preserve functionality while also boosting safety.
Finally, think about recalibrating the TV settings occasionally to fine-tune picture and sound quality as both technology and personal preferences develop. With these maintenance tips in mind, home theater enthusiasts can experience a seamless and visually impressive home cinema experience over the long term.

How Much Time Does a Professional TV Wall Mounting Service Usually Require?
A professional TV wall mounting service generally takes one to two hours, influenced by factors including the wall type, complexity of installation, and extra features. Every situation is different, affecting the overall time required for proper installation.
Can I Mount a TV on a Brick or Concrete Wall?
Absolutely, a TV is able to be mounted on a concrete or brick wall. Using the correct tools and anchors is critical for secure installation, making sure the television is securely supported and placed for perfect viewing experiences.
What Weight Capacity Should I Look for in Wall Mounts?
When choosing wall mounts, one must take into account the manufacturer's specified weight limits, generally ranging from 50 to 150 pounds, according to the model selected. Additionally, the integrity of the wall structure impacts general support and safety.
